Expressing unit labor cost in this way shows that increases in hourly compensation tend to increase unit labor costs, and increases in output per hour worked—labor productivity—tend to reduce them. If the overtime is due to abnormal reasons like machine break down, power failure, the overtime premium is charged to costing profit and loss account directly, as an abnormal cost. If a worker works for more than 9 hours in a day or for more than 48 hours in a week, he is treated to have worked overtime and is given wages at double the normal rate for such time. The wages are calculated at normal rate up to 9 hours and at double the normal rate for hours worked beyond 9 hours in a day or calculated at single rate up to 48 hours and at double the normal rate beyond 48 hours.
